Default Is there a way to keep Reaper from reacting to MMC?

Hello everybody,

I'm new here but I've been a Reaper user since 2.55
Not a seasoned MIDI tweaker, though.

I have some devices (Roland VS 1680) that I use as Midi Controllers for Reaper. Happily receiving CC in Reaper. All good.

Now those devices have transport buttons (Play, Stop, etc.) which I want to be able to press WITHOUT Reaper reacting to it.

Those transport buttons do not send CC, but instead Midi Machine Control (MMC) being sysex messages AFAIK.
Reaper reacts to the transport buttons when I enable it to receive CC. I cannot find a way to make reaper receive CC but ignore MMC.

Is it even possible?
